Lady Gaga Plans Free Concert for One Million Fans at Copacabana Beach

News summary

Lady Gaga is set to perform a free concert titled 'Mayhem On The Beach' at Copacabana Beach in Rio de Janeiro on May 3, marking her first show in Brazil since 2012. The event, part of the Todo Mundo no Rio initiative, will be open to the public on a first-come, first-served basis and will be broadcast live on Multishow and TV Globo. Gaga expressed her excitement on Instagram, recalling her previous hospitalization that led to the cancellation of her last performance in Brazil, and emphasized the significance of Brazilian fans in her career. The concert coincides with the release of her seventh studio album, 'Mayhem', due out on March 7, and features three singles already released. Organizers are hopeful the concert will attract a record-breaking audience, surpassing Madonna's 1.6 million attendees from last year. Gaga has stated she is working hard to ensure the performance will be unforgettable for fans.
